The following are the Gateway Business District minimum setbacks: <br />• Front yard — 50 feet <br />• Side Yard (interior) — 20 feet/40 feet combination <br />• Rear Yard — 20 feet <br />• Off -Street Parking from ROW — 50 feet <br />• Off -Street Parking from Side or Rear Property Lines — 20 feet <br />The survey shows the parking lot is approximately 10 feet from the south property line and the <br />building is approximately 14 feet from the north property line. As a legal nonconforming structure <br />and use, the property can continue to operate in the same or a similar manner without any changes <br />to the site. <br />Aerial Map of Subject Property <br />Section 1350 - Nonconforming Uses, Buildings, and Lots <br />In evaluating nonconforming uses, buildings, and lots, the City shall refer to City Code Section <br />1350 which mirrors the regulations of State Statute 462.357 for determining what type(s) of <br />activity (i.e. continuation, rebuild, maintenance, expansion, etc.) may or may not be allowed. <br />Nonconformities are simply any land uses, structures or lots that do not comply with the current <br />zoning ordinance of a city. Legal nonconformities are those uses, buildings, or lots that legally <br />complied with the existing zoning ordinance when the new zoning ordinance or amendment was <br />adopted. The intent of these regulations is to allow nonconforming uses of land or building to be <br />continued, including through repair, replacement, restoration, maintenance, or improvement, but <br />not including expansion.
